Born in 1967 and from a small northern town called Mansfield, Peter Smith is a contemporary fine artist based in Britain. The subject for which he is most well known is a striped rotund creature with the form of a hippopotamus but the stripes of a zebra. These creatures are depicted in a variety of saccharine poses and are known to fans of his art as 'Zeppos' or 'Impossimals'.
Peter is a self-taught artist who in 2005 decided to bring his work to a wider audience;[1] working in the fashion industry for the previous 16 years gave Peter a great understanding of form and colour which when fused with contemporary living imagery provides powerful visual art to suit all tastes. Created using oils Peters work is gradually painted over a six week period to produce large canvas versions of his numerous illustrations and sketches. The size and composition of the originals give depth, clarity and a look that's difficult to pigeonhole but very accessible.
The 'Art of Surprise' was Peters first collection with his fine art publisher Washington Green and a steady increase in his popularity coupled with a flow of stunning new releases has contributed towards his growing success in 2005. After winning 'Castle Galleries Artist of the Year 2005', Peter Completed his first national tour in 2006 with his critically acclaimed 'Tails of the Unexpected' exhibition and recently completed his new tour 'Far Beyond Driven' which has firmly established him as one of the countries most collectable artists earning him a runner up place in the Fine Art Trade Guild 'Best Up and Coming UK Artist 2007'.

After two years and four tours Peter's work has now become highly collectable in many countries and can be sourced in the USA, Japan, Spain, Denmark and many other places throughout the world.
[edit] Brief Major Release History
- May 2005 The Art of Surprise
- Feb 2006 Tails of the Unexpected
- Jun 2006 Smithy's World Cup Heroes
- Feb 2007 Far Beyond Driven
